Step Back into RTS Greatness in Dawn of War Definitive Edition
Warhammer 40,000: Dawn of War – Definitive Edition marks the triumphant return of one of the most iconic real-time strategy games ever made, fully remastered for a modern audience. Originally released in 2004, Dawn of War – Definitive Edition set the gold standard for fast-paced, cinematic RTS battles set in the grim darkness of the Warhammer 40K universe.
Dawn of War – Definitive Edition bundles the original game together with all three standalone expansions—Winter Assault, Dark Crusade, and Soulstorm—delivering four full single-player campaigns and over 200 multiplayer maps in one massive package.
The remaster goes far beyond a simple graphical polish. Fully optimized for modern systems, the game now supports 4K resolution, widescreen displays, and a revamped HUD. Textures are up to four times sharper, lighting and shadows are dramatically enhanced, and units boast improved reflections and visual effects for a richer battlefield atmosphere.
Gameplay refinements such as improved camera controls, better pathfinding, and 64-bit architecture bring smoother, more responsive action. Modding support has also been streamlined, allowing fans to easily access and manage two decades’ worth of community creations through the integrated Mod Manager.
Launching on August 14, 2025, for PC via Steam and GOG, Dawn of War – Definitive Edition is both a nostalgic journey for veterans and a perfect entry point for newcomers. In the grim darkness of the far future, there is only war—and now it’s sharper, faster, and more spectacular than ever.
